School blown up in Nowshera

Published
0

NOWSHERA, Oct 10: A government primary school was blown up by unidentified militants at Usmanabad area of Akora Khattak early Wednesday.

Official sources said substantial damage was caused to the building and added that the watchman was not present in the school at the time of blast.

Soon after the incident, police and bomb disposal squad were rushed to the site. The bomb disposal squad declared that 4 to 6 kilograms of explosives were used in the blast. —Correspondent
